Amphastar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(AMPH) — WACC Analysis

WACC Breakdown

Amphastar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(AMPH) has a weighted average cost of capital (WACC) of 7.0%. The cost of equity is 9.2%, derived from a beta of 1.00 and a risk-free rate of 5.0%. The after-tax cost of debt is 3.4%. The capital structure is 62.5% equity and 37.5% debt.

Interpretation

A WACC of 7.0% suggests that the market views Amphastar Pharmaceuticals, Inc. as relatively low-risk, with a lower cost of financing.

Investors can compare AMPH's WACC of 7.0% against industry peers to gauge its relative financing costs. A beta of 1.00 reflects the stock's volatility relative to the broader market.

Amphastar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(AMPH) WACC in context

Amphastar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(AMPH) currently screens with an estimated WACC of 7.02%. That blends a 9.19% cost of equity, a 4.29% pre-tax cost of debt, and a 62.53% equity weight into the discount rate you would typically use in a DCF model.

How this page calculates AMPH

This page combines CAPM-based cost of equity with SEC-derived debt and capital structure inputs. The current beta is 1.00 and equity accounts for 62.53% of capital.
